Highway People's Town Network (NEXCO EAST Tohoku Regional Head Office [Miyagi Ward, Sendai City] and others) will be holding the "Highway Festa Tohoku 2025"at Kotodai Park in Sendai City on Saturday, September 20th and Sunday, September 21st, 2025.
This event will feature a variety of "regional specialties," such as local performing arts and gourmet food from the six Tohoku prefectures connected by Expressway, allowing visitors to enjoy and rediscover the charms of the Tohoku region.
This event has been attended by approximately 1 million people to date, and thanks to your support, is now in its 22nd year. There will be a variety of gourmet and stage events, so please come and join us with your family and friends.

Four. Event content

Performances of local performing arts from six Tohoku prefectures

(Aomori Prefecture) Hachinohe Enburi
(Iwate Prefecture) Sansa Dance
(Akita Prefecture) Namahage Taiko [NAMAHAGE Go Kagura]
(Miyagi Prefecture) Sendai Sparrow Dance
(Yamagata Prefecture) Hanagasa Dance
(Fukushima Prefecture) Hula Dance [Spa Resort Hawaiians Dancing Team]

What is Hiway Jingai Net?

Image image of the logo of the people town net

NEXCO EAST Tohoku Regional Head Office is working to improve the vitality of the entire six Tohoku prefectures by discovering and widely promoting attractive tourism resources and revitalizing inter-regional exchanges. It has set up "regional liaison committees" in each prefecture and organized the "Highway People's Town Network" with the aim of working together with the local community. In addition to hosting "Highway Festa Tohoku 2025," NEXCO EAST Tohoku Regional Head Office will work to improve the vitality of the entire six Tohoku prefectures through various initiatives that promote the attractions of the region through Expressway.
